(MENAFN) Swissotel Hotels and Resorts unveiled plans to construct a second luxury property in the Middle East, as it seeks to benefit from the growing travel and tourism sector in the region, reported Arabian Business.
The group said it will build the Swissotel Jadaf Dubai in the emirate of Dubai, and is scheduled to open in 2016.
Swissotel is partnering with Aabar Properties, a real estate development, management and investment company on the project.
The planned 280-key hotel will be the second, after opening the first one in the holy city of Makkah.
The new hotel will be built in a mixed use development comprising three hotels, residences, serviced apartments, retail & entertainment facilities.
It will also feature an all-day dining restaurant, three speciality restaurants, a Purovel Spa and meeting, conference and ballroom facilities.”
